In India, AI was used during the coronavirus pandemic to reopen factories safely by providing camera, cell phone, and smart wearable device-based technology to ensure social distancing, take employee temperatures at regular intervals, and perform contact tracing if anyone tested positive for the virus. An AI program called AI-SAFE (Automated Intelligent System for Assuring Safe Working Environments) aims to automate the workplace personal protective equipment (PPE) check, eliminating human errors that could cause accidents in the workplace. For example, 50 percent of construction companies that used drones to inspect roofs and other risky tasks saw improvements in safety.
